Market Size
Global Nickel Titanium Alloy market was valued at USD 739 million in 2024 and is projected to reach USD 1351 million by 2031, with a compound annual growth rate (CAGR) of 9.2%.
Ni‑Ti alloy, also known as Nitinol, is composed of nearly equal parts of nickel and titanium and belongs to the class of shape memory alloys. The core manufacturers include Confluent Medical (NDC) and SAES Getters, with North America, Europe, and Asia‑Pacific accounting for 45%, 20%, and 30% of the market share, respectively. Wire/rod/bar is the largest product segment, constituting over 70% share, with medical applications being the largest end‑use, followed by aircraft applications.
Nickel Titanium Alloy, also known as Ni‑Ti alloy or Nitinol, is an equiatomic composition of nickel and titanium. It is classified as a shape memory alloy that can be deformed at low temperatures and regain its original shape when exposed to higher temperatures.
Product Definition
Ni‑Ti alloys are engineered to exhibit shape memory and superelastic behavior, enabling them to return to a pre‑defined shape upon heating or to sustain large strains without permanent deformation. These properties make them ideal for biomedical implants, aerospace actuators, automotive components, and consumer electronics.
